Instructions
Soak the dried shrimp
Soak the dried shrimp in freshly boiled water while you get the other ingredients going.
1 heaped Tbsp dried shrimp
Other Prep Work
Peel the cucumber, halve then halve again, lengthwise. See image.
1 large cucumber
Slice the cucumber quarters on the diagonal and place in a colander. Sprinkle with 1 Tbsp of salt and leave while you move on to the next steps.This salting is to draw out any bitterness in the cucumber, depending on the variety you're using. The older your cucumber, the more pronounced that bitterness can be.The added advantage of salting the cucumbers is that they take on a bot of the saltiness and also soften slightly.
1 Tbsp salt
Peel, halve and slice the shallots thinly. Separate the layers as much as you can, but no need to be too fastidious about this.
2 shallots or 1 small red onion
If you are adding fresh chillies, chop them up finely. I left them whole, as you can see in the images.
2 birds eye chillies for added heat
Drain and Chop/Pound the Shrimp
Drain the dried shrimp and place in a mortar or imagine you're in the 21st century and tip into a chopper.
Pound the dried shrimp to a semi fine state or until you get tired! If using a chopper, pulse the shrimp a few times until you get a floss like mix, with the odd lump of shrimp.
Toss the Salad
Rinse the cucumber slices well under running water and give them a good shake to remove excess water. Tip into a large bowl.
Follow the cucumber with the shallots, chillies, dried shrimp, salt and sugar.
1 pinch salt, 1 pinch white sugar
Add 2 Tbsp of sambal belacan, or more, if you like.
2 Tbsp sambal belacan (click for recipe)
And finally, drizzle the lime juice all over.
1 Tbsp fresh lime juice
Toss your salad and taste a cucumber. Add more salt if you want. Serve immediately.
